Decision modeling for the detection and identification of micro-drone in the electronic warfare battlefield With the effect of cost and operating range components based on game theory

Abstract:

Today , economic centers such as refineries, political centers such as parliament, government, judiciary and military centers such as barracks can be attacked by spy or suicide Mini-drones. Various systems and methods have been proposed to detect and identify this threat. Since this issue is a competition between two groups of defenders and attackers, several factors are effective in the decision-making of these two groups, their operational approach and the optimal selection of equipment. In this research, by using the game theory based on the graph model, we have been able to, in the first step, by considering the two parameters of cost and budget in equipping the electronic warfare , as well as the operational range of the systems in two independent scenarios, considering the equipment of the parties and the preferences of the actors. Predict the battle scene and the equilibrium situations based on game theory.In the second step, by combining these two components and simultaneously applying the influence of the decision parameters in a cost function, we predict the final state of detection and identification of the Mini drone and, taking into account the real conditions, we model the correct decision-making process for the commanders of the battlefield of electronic warfare. The results show that the simultaneous effect of two parameters, cost and operating range, have completely opposite results with one-dimensional decisions. Also, the cost function can be effective in changing the results
